Dictionary![]() ![]() car•na•tionPronunciation: (kär-nā'shun), [key] —n. 1. any of numerous cultivated varieties of the clove pink, Dianthus caryophyllus, having long-stalked, fragrant, usually double flowers in a variety of colors: the state flower of Ohio. 2. pink; light red. 3. Obs.the color of flesh. —adj. having the color carnation. Random House Unabridged Dictionary, Copyright © 1997, by Random House, Inc., on Infoplease.
